Fact: The 'raw' cashews you buy at the grocery store have already been heat-treated, because the shells of unprocessed cashews contain urushiol, the same toxic oil found in poison ivy. Understanding what toxins cashews contain is key to appreciating the safety of the nuts you buy from the store.

The notion of eating cashews straight from the tree is a dangerous misconception due to a naturally occurring toxin. While you can't eat raw cashew nuts raw, all store-bought cashews, including those labeled "raw," have been cooked to some degree to remove the poisonous oil that surrounds the shell.
